                        Where the money goes:
                        When you give $1 to the regular offering at your church, this is how it is used. 90 cents remains with your local church. 8 cents supports ministry in the district, annual conference, and jurisdiction. 2 cents goes to the denominationrsquo;s apportioned funds. 
                        mdash;United Methodist News Service, Nov. 17, 2011

            Day at Legislature: Feb. 13
            On Feb. 13, criminal justice and immigration will be spotlighted at the state Capitol during the Day at the Legislature, sponsored by the Oklahoma Conference of Churches, an ecumenical group.
            Keynote speakers will be Rep. Kris Steele, who is speaker of the House and a member of Shawnee-Wesley UMC, and Father Don Wolfe, chairman of St. Gregoryrsquo;s University.

            In memoriam
            Rev. Wesley Robert Kimball, 86, of Sherman, Texas, died Dec. 25, 2011. His pastoral career began in 1950, and he retired in 1987. He also served 33 years in the U.S. military.
            Wes was born March 31, 1925, in Fairview. He married Shirley Reed on Dec. 5, 1964.
            He pastored at Marshall, Yewed/Prairie Valley, Sulphur-St. Paul, Gene Autry, Martha, Lawton-Sullivan Village, and Quinton.             The chapel offices overflowed again this Christmas season, with an outpouring of gifts from the OCU community for the Angel Tree families at Skyline Urban Ministry, a United Methodist-related mission in Oklahoma City. 
            A total of 82 individuals-16 families and 14 senior citizensmdash;were the happy recipients of those gifts.
            As part of the project, the OCU Athletic Department again sponsored a canned food drive.
